"Jousma, David" <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:  Howard,

I would have to ask why you would want to intentionally apply a fix
known to be in error? Maybe you should just exclude it for now. Pretty
much the ONLY time I will bypass an error, is at the direction of IBM
support, or if I am applying a FUNCTION(new product), and need to get it
installed.

Mark Jacobs wrote: This is telling you that
the function HDZ11G0 has a new HIPER apar written against it. The apar
name is AA09560 and is displayable in IBMLINK as OA09560.
